29.5% of the people in Douglas County are religious:
- 0.6% are Baptist
- 0.3% are Episcopalian
- 10.6% are Catholic
- 1.3% are Lutheran
- 2.0% are Methodist
- 0.9% are Pentecostal
- 0.1% are Presbyterian
- 3.6% are Church of Jesus Christ
- 9.3% are another Christian faith
- 0.5% are Judaism
- 0.1% are an eastern faith
- 0.0% affilitates with Islam
